Receding flood waters reveal York shipwreck again

A shipwreck that appears from time to time on Short Sands Beach in York was uncovered by rough seas that pounded the shore all weekend. Jordan Hersom, Julie Johnson named football, soccer coaches at York

Jordan Hersom, the 2011 Fitzpatrick Trophy winner, has been chosen as York High’s new football coach, the school announced Thursday. The high school also has selected Julie Johnson as its new boys’ soccer coach.
